Qualcomm Reveals Key Challenges for Next-Gen XR Glasses

The Future of Extended Reality (XR) Hinges on Industry Collaboration

Qualcomm, a leader in mobile chipset technology, is at the forefront of developing hardware for extended reality (XR) — an umbrella term encompassing virtual reality (VR), augmented reality (AR), and mixed reality (MR). At the Augmented World Expo (AWE), Tim Leland, VP of Product Management at Qualcomm, outlined the critical hurdles the industry must overcome to make XR glasses mainstream.

The Current State of XR: Progress and Pain Points

Qualcomm is actively supporting XR development through:

  • Snapdragon 835 VR HMD dev kits for developers
  • Partnerships with companies like ODG, Leap Motion, and SMI
  • Advancements in 6DoF (six degrees of freedom) tracking and eye-tracking algorithms

However, Leland emphasized that XR still faces significant technical challenges:

  1. Visual Realism: AR objects often appear fake due to improper lighting and shadow rendering.
  2. Power Consumption: High-performance processing drains battery life quickly.
  3. Form Factor: Future XR glasses must be lightweight and socially acceptable.
  4. Latency: Seamless AR/VR requires ultra-low motion-to-photon latency.
  5. Content Ecosystem: More engaging applications are needed for mass adoption.

Key Technical Hurdles

1. Lighting and Shadows

  • Without accurate lighting, virtual objects fail to blend naturally into real-world environments.
  • Solving this requires advanced visual processing, increasing power demands.

2. Battery Life and Performance

  • High-fidelity XR experiences demand significant computational power.
  • Foveated rendering (focusing processing on the user’s gaze point) can help optimize efficiency.

3. Wireless and Self-Contained Design

  • Future XR glasses must be cable-free and fanless for consumer appeal.
  • 5G connectivity will enable low-latency streaming for video content.

The Road Ahead: A 30-Year Evolution

Leland compared XR’s development to the smartphone revolution:

  • Current Phase (1990s Analogy): Early adoption, refining hardware and software.
  • 2020s and Beyond: Expected surge in consumer adoption as devices improve.
  • Mass Market Potential: Hundreds of millions of units annually by the 2030s.

Industry Collaboration is Critical

Leland stressed that no single company can solve XR’s challenges alone. Key areas requiring industry-wide cooperation include:

  • Standardizing foveated rendering for better power efficiency
  • Improving hand and eye-tracking algorithms
  • Developing low-latency 5G streaming solutions

Gaming and Future Applications

  • AR Gaming: Could revive classic board games in digital form.
  • VR Gaming: Major publishers are optimizing titles for mobile VR.
  • Professional Use Cases: Firefighters, engineers, and first responders may adopt specialized XR glasses.

The 5G Factor

5G will revolutionize XR by enabling:

  • 8K 120fps streaming with ultra-low latency
  • Free-viewpoint video (allowing users to “walk around” in recorded scenes)
  • Cloud-assisted rendering to reduce on-device processing

When Will XR Feel “Real”?

Leland predicts that by the mid-2030s, some XR experiences may become indistinguishable from reality. However, ethical concerns, such as deepfake-like manipulations in AR, will also emerge.
